The Wiki Way of Learning : Creating Learning Experiences Using Collaborative Web Pages /

A collection of essays on creating and managing learning processes using collaborative technologies. From set-up to evaluation, you'll discover practical examples of different uses of wikis from primary school to university level. Includes hands-on hints on how to start and use wikis for collab...
